Job DescriptionPharmaceutical Technician to join our team on site in Manorhamilton Road, Sligo on a 12 month fixed term contract. This role is rotational shift work.
In this role you will be responsible for producing drug product materials as per organizational needs in line with all relevant compliance requirements. You will operate as a team member in a pharmaceutical processing facility in line with all regulatory and organizational requirements.
Responsibilities- Pharmaceutical processing activities in our manufacturing building and support locations.
- Team coordination to maximise the effectiveness of the team members.
- Documentation of all activities in line with cGMP requirements.
- Cross training within the team and training of new team members.
- Participation in continuous improvement programs to implement improvements in the quality, safety, environmental and production systems.
- Execution of commissioning and validation protocols on an ongoing basis.
- Maintaining the overall cGMP of the pharmaceutical processing areas.
- Adheres to and supports all EHS & E standards, procedures, and policies.
- 3rd level qualification, preferably in Engineering or Science related fields OR 2+ years in a GMP regulated environment.
- Experience of operating in a highly automated environment.
- Good I.T. skills are required.
